Key Features to Consider
When shopping for wireless earbuds with neckbands, there are several key features to take into account. First and foremost is sound quality. Look for earbuds that support high-resolution audio and have good noise isolation or cancellation capabilities. Features like aptX support can also enhance audio clarity and reduce latency, particularly for video playback.
Another critical feature is battery life. Depending on your intended use, you may need earbuds that can last through long sessions without recharging. Check the ratings for both continuous playtime and standby time to ensure they meet your daily needs. Additionally, fast charging capabilities can be a game-changer for users who are often short on time.
Comfort and fit are also essential considerations. Opt for models that come with multiple ear tip sizes to ensure a snug fit. Bluetooth range is another aspect worth noting; a longer range can provide more freedom to move around without losing audio connection. Finally, dust and water resistance ratings, such as IPX4, can be important for those who plan to use their earbuds during workouts or in outdoor settings.

Maintenance and Care Tips
To ensure the longevity of your wireless earbuds with neckbands, proper maintenance and care are crucial. Start by regularly cleaning the earbuds and neckband. Use a microfiber cloth to wipe down the surfaces and keep them free from debris, sweat, or moisture, which can affect sound quality and comfort. For the ear tips, consider removing them for thorough cleaning; most can be rinsed with water and air-dried before reattaching.
Battery care is also essential for maximizing the lifespan of your earbuds. Avoid leaving them plugged in for extended periods once fully charged, as this can degrade the battery over time. Instead, charge them only when necessary and try to maintain a charge between 20% and 80% whenever possible. This practice can help prolong the overall battery health.
Additionally, storing your earbuds correctly will protect them from potential damage. Use the carrying case when they are not in use and avoid exposing them to extreme temperatures or moisture. Keeping them away from direct sunlight and preventing them from tangling with other accessories can also help maintain their condition. By following these tips, you can enhance the performance and durability of your wireless neckband earbuds.

4. Connectivity
A stable and efficient connection is vital for an enjoyable listening experience. Most wireless earbuds utilize Bluetooth technology for connectivity, so opt for models that feature the latest Bluetooth versions, such as 5.0 or above. These versions provide more stable connections, improved ranges, and better energy efficiency, which can lead to longer battery life.
Additionally, consider whether the earbuds support multi-device pairing. This feature allows you to connect your earbuds to multiple devices simultaneously, making it easier to switch between them without needing to disconnect and reconnect constantly. Check for the range of connectivity as well, as some earbuds can maintain a connection from a more extended distance than others, which is essential for active users.

How do I connect wireless earbuds with neckband to my device?
Connecting wireless earbuds with neckband to your device is typically a straightforward process. First, ensure that the earbuds are fully charged. Once charged, activate the pairing mode by holding down the designated button on the neckband until you see a flashing LED light, indicating that they are discoverable. Next, go to the Bluetooth settings on your smartphone, tablet, or computer.
Once in the Bluetooth settings, you should see the name of your earbuds displayed in the list of available devices. Tap on the name to connect. Upon successful connection, you may hear an audio prompt, and the LED light may change color to indicate that it is linked. If you encounter any issues, consult the user manual for troubleshooting tips or resetting the connection.
What is the average price range for wireless earbuds with neckband?
The price range for wireless earbuds with neckband design can vary significantly based on brand, features, and audio quality. On the lower end, you can find basic models starting around $30 to $60, which typically offer decent sound quality and essential features such as Bluetooth connectivity and a modest battery life. These earbuds are great for casual listeners who don’t require advanced functionalities.
Mid-range options generally cost between $60 and $150, often incorporating better sound quality, noise cancellation, and longer battery life. High-end models, which can range from $150 to $300 or more, come with premium features like advanced audio technology, customizable sound profiles, and superior build quality. Investing more in a higher-end model can enhance your listening experience significantly.
